![]() The availability of the feature creation tools, or construction tools, depends on the type of template you have selected at the top of the window. The top panel of the Create Features window shows the templates in the map, while the bottom panel of the window lists the tools available to create features of that type. To reduce clutter, templates are hidden on the Create Features window when layers are not visible. Choosing a feature template on the Create Features window sets up the editing environment based on that feature template's properties this action sets the target layer in which your new features will be stored, activates a feature construction tool, and prepares to assign the default attributes to the feature you create. You can open it by clicking the Create Features button on the Editor toolbar. Create Features windowĪnytime you create features on the map, you start with the Create Features window. To edit data, you need to add the Editor toolbar to ArcMap by clicking the Editor Toolbar button on the Standard toolbar. ![]() From the Editor toolbar, you can start and stop an edit session, access a variety of tools and commands to create new features and modify existing ones, and save your edits. The Editor toolbar contains the various commands you will need to edit your data. The primary pieces of the editing user interface include the Editor toolbar and several windows and dialog boxes that are opened from it.
